The Fat Radish Goes to France for Limited Engagement

Source: The Sporting Project
Team Silkstone has its hands full of late, what with running a mini Lower East Side empire (nay, monopoly) at the bottom of Orchard Street – Fat Radish, the newly-christened Leadbelly, and the forthcoming Two Good Traders restaurant. Capitalizing on this local success and mainstream exposure, chef Ben Towill and artistic designer Phil Winser are crossing the Atlantic for a brief engagement in France.
Indeed, starting next week, the Fat Radish is participating in a “pop-up dinner series” at Paris restaurant Bob’s Kitchen. Hosted by creative agency The Sporting Project, the event runs from September 26 through October 2.
